| drone [ drōn ] |
verb (past and past participle droned, present participle dron·ing, 3rd person present singular drones) |
|
| Definition: |
| |
1. intransitive verb make low humming sound: to make a continuous low humming sound
|
2. transitive and intransitive verb talk in boring voice: to talk or say something in a boring voice, usually for a long time
 I could hear his voice droning on in the background.
|
noun (plural drones) |
|
| Definition: |
| |
1. low humming sound: a continuous low humming sound
|
2. music unchanging note held during melody: a single note or chord that is held through a melodic part
|
3. music pipe in bagpipes producing continuous note: the pipe in a set of bagpipes that produces a single continuous note
|
| [Early 16th century. <drone2] |
|
 dron·ing·ly adverb |
